"El Steinway a la Guillotina" is a captivating live album by the enigmatic Pascal Comelade, released on September 15, 2014, under DiscMedi S.A. This collection of 14 tracks, recorded during live performances, offers a unique insight into Comelade's eclectic musical prowess, spanning a total duration of 1 hour and 6 minutes. The album features a blend of experimental compositions and playful interpretations, including a notable cover of The Rolling Stones' "Under My Thumb."
Comelade, known for his avant-garde approach to music, delivers an array of intriguing pieces that showcase his versatility and innovation. From the whimsical "Pim Pam Pum al Concepte" to the dramatic "Russian Roulette," each track is a testament to his distinctive style. The album also includes a second live recording of "L'argot del Soroll," highlighting the dynamic range of his performances.
